Yatesville is moderately more affordable than Alto, with a 5.6% lower cost of living index. Alto scores 73 compared to 69 for Yatesville,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Alto can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

On the housing front, median rent in Alto is $927/month compared to $860/month in Yatesville — a 8%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Yatesville has cheaper rent, Alto actually has lower median home values ($132,900 vs $137,500).

Median household income in Alto is $54,479 compared to $73,438 in Yatesville (-25.8%). Yatesville off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Alto spend roughly 20.4% of their income on rent, more than the 14.1% in Yatesville.
